Vilnius

Vilnius is the capital and largest city in the country of Lithuania. It has a population of more than 500,000 residents and is located in the valley between the Neris River and the Vilnia River in the southeastern part of the country. Visitors come to the city for its beautiful Old Town, impressive architecture, and fascinating culture. In 2009 it was named the European Capital of Culture along with the city of Linz, in Austria.

Toronto

The capital of Ontario and the most populated city in Canada, Toronto is a very popular travel destination for any number of reasons. It's positioned along the coast of Lake Ontario and has a population of more than 2.6 million with 6.2 million in the Greater Toronto Area. It's a very international and diverse city, with a very rich cultural history. More than half of the city's population was not born in Canada, and there are more than eighty different ethnic neighborhoods sprinkled throughout the city. The city is a center for music, theater, film, and television. It has countless museums, festivals, and sights that attract more than 25 million tourists every year.

Which place is cheaper, Toronto or Vilnius?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ations.

The average daily cost (per person) in Vilnius is €94, while the average daily cost in Toronto is €190.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Vilnius and Toronto in more detail.

When is the best time to visit Vilnius or Toronto?

Both places have a temperate climate with four distinct seasons. As both cities are in the northern hemisphere, summer is in July and winter is in January.

Should I visit Vilnius or Toronto in the Summer?

Both Toronto and Vilnius during the summer are popular places to visit. Most visitors come to Vilnius for the family-friendly experiences during these months.

In July, Vilnius is generally cooler than Toronto. Daily temperatures in Vilnius average around 18°C (65°F), and Toronto fluctuates around 21°C (70°F).

In Toronto, it's very sunny this time of the year. It's quite sunny in Vilnius. In the summer, Vilnius often gets less sunshine than Toronto. Vilnius gets 219 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Toronto receives 281 hours of full sun.

Vilnius usually gets more rain in July than Toronto. Vilnius gets 78 mm (3.1 in) of rain, while Toronto receives 69 mm (2.7 in) of rain this time of the year.

Should I visit Vilnius or Toronto in the Autumn?

The autumn attracts plenty of travelers to both Vilnius and Toronto. The autumn months attract visitors to Vilnius because of the shopping scene and the natural beauty of the area.

Vilnius is cooler than Toronto in the autumn. The daily temperature in Vilnius averages around 8°C (46°F) in October, and Toronto fluctuates around 11°C (51°F).

Vilnius usually receives less sunshine than Toronto during autumn. Vilnius gets 94 hours of sunny skies, while Toronto receives 153 hours of full sun in the autumn.

In October, Vilnius usually receives less rain than Toronto. Vilnius gets 53 mm (2.1 in) of rain, while Toronto receives 61 mm (2.4 in) of rain each month for the autumn.

Should I visit Vilnius or Toronto in the Winter?

The winter brings many poeple to Vilnius as well as Toronto. The museums, the shopping scene, and the cuisine are the main draw to Vilnius this time of year.

Be prepared for some very cold days in Toronto. It's quite cold in Vilnius in the winter. In the winter, Vilnius is cooler than Toronto. Typically, the winter temperatures in Vilnius in January average around -5°C (23°F), and Toronto averages at about -4°C (25°F).

In the winter, Vilnius often gets less sunshine than Toronto. Vilnius gets 36 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Toronto receives 87 hours of full sun.

Vilnius usually gets less rain in January than Toronto. Vilnius gets 41 mm (1.6 in) of rain, while Toronto receives 52 mm (2 in) of rain this time of the year.

Should I visit Vilnius or Toronto in the Spring?

Both Toronto and Vilnius are popular destinations to visit in the spring with plenty of activities. Many travelers come to Vilnius for the natural beauty.

In April, Vilnius is generally around the same temperature as Toronto. Daily temperatures in Vilnius average around 7°C (45°F), and Toronto fluctuates around 7°C (44°F).

Vilnius usually receives less sunshine than Toronto during spring. Vilnius gets 164 hours of sunny skies, while Toronto receives 179 hours of full sun in the spring.

In April, Vilnius usually receives less rain than Toronto. Vilnius gets 46 mm (1.8 in) of rain, while Toronto receives 63 mm (2.5 in) of rain each month for the spring.
